Prashant Palkar presented a paper in PCO, IPDPS 2015
Prashant Palkar, a Ph.D. student, presented a paper titled "A Branch-and-Estimate heuristic procedure for solving nonconvex integer optimization problems", a joint work with Prof. Ashutosh Mahajan, in the workshop on Parallel Computing and Optimization (PCO) in conjunction with 29th IEEE International Parallel & Distributed Processing Symposium (IPDPS). The conference was held during May 25-29, 2015, at Hyderabad, India. More details can be seen here.

IEOR organised a workshop on operations planning and strategy on Indian Railways
Prof. Narayan Rangaraj and his collaborators organised on May 30 a workshop at IIT Bombay for operations planning and strategy in railways. The workshop brought together several experts and officials from CRIS, Railway Board, Western Railway and Central Railway divisions of the Indian Railways, and also researchers from industry and academia. The workshop featured talks, a panel discussion and a poster session.
